Haystack
Open-source LLM framework for building NLP pipelines
⭐18,000
Data & ETLFree (open-source)
About Haystack
Haystack by deepset is a comprehensive NLP framework for building production-ready RAG pipelines, question answering systems, and search applications. It provides a clean pipeline abstraction and supports multiple LLM backends.
Features
✦Pipeline builder
✦RAG
✦Document processing
✦Model serving
✦REST API
Pros & Cons
Pros
- +Production-grade RAG pipelines
- +Clean pipeline abstraction
- +Strong documentation
- +Multiple backend support
- +Enterprise ready
Cons
- −Steeper learning curve than LlamaIndex
- −Less community content
- −Breaking changes between versions
- −Heavy framework
Platforms
LinuxmacOSWindowsDocker
Tags
Related AI Concepts
Similar Tools
Unstructured
ETL for unstructured data — PDFs, images, HTML to LLM-ready
Free (open-source) + APILlamaIndex
Data framework for connecting LLMs to external data
Free (open-source) + CloudFirecrawl
Turn websites into LLM-ready markdown or structured data
Free (open-source) + CloudCrawl4AI
Open-source LLM-friendly web crawler and scraper
Free (open-source)📰 Featured In
All guides →Category
Browse all Data & ETL tools →Need help choosing?
Compare Haystack with alternatives side by side
Compare Tools →